Massachusetts Hispanic Asian alone Male or Men Population By County in 2012

Updated on July 2, 2025.

Based on the US Census Vintage data estimates, in 2012, the Massachusetts Hispanic Asian alone male population was 2,722; and represented 0.08% of the total Massachusetts male population in 2012.

Middlesex County had the highest number of Hispanic Asian alone male population (638), followed by Essex County (579), and Suffolk County (573).

On the other hand, Dukes County had the lowest Hispanic Asian alone male population (2), followed by Nantucket County (3), and Franklin County (5).
